Have you ever met someone and thought, “Well… that was suspiciously well-timed.” Maybe they appeared the week you were questioning your career, recovering from heartbreak, or dramatically telling the universe, “Send me a sign!” (The universe has a flair for theatrics.)
Many spiritual traditions believe that certain people enter our lives as catalysts rather than permanent companions. Psychology offers a different but complementary perspective: meaningful coincidences—what Carl Jung famously called synchronicity—can feel deeply significant because they align with important moments in our inner lives. Whether you see these encounters as divine timing, fate, or simply beautifully timed human connections, they often leave us changed. Jung described synchronicity as meaningful coincidence, while modern psychology notes that such experiences are personally meaningful without proving a supernatural cause.
Here are seven signs someone may have wandered into your story for a spiritual reason.

4. Strange Coincidences Keep Happening Around Them
You think about them, and they text. You mention Iceland, and they’ve booked a flight there. You both own the same obscure childhood book featuring a pirate goose. At some point you stop saying, “That’s random,” and start raising one suspicious eyebrow at the cosmos.
These experiences resemble Jung’s idea of synchronicity: meaningful coincidences that feel connected because of their personal significance rather than obvious cause and effect. Importantly, psychology distinguishes the feeling of meaning from proof that supernatural forces are involved, encouraging people to balance intuition with common sense.
The key isn’t counting every repeated number on a license plate like you’re collecting Pokémon cards. Instead, notice whether these coincidences inspire genuine reflection or positive action. Spiritual signs are often less about predicting the future and more about helping you pay closer attention to the present.

7. Their Purpose Isn’t Necessarily to Stay Forever
This might be the hardest spiritual lesson of all: meaningful doesn’t always mean permanent.
We often assume the most important people should remain in our lives forever, but many spiritual traditions suggest that some connections exist to complete a chapter rather than the entire book. A friendship may end after teaching confidence. A relationship might conclude once both people have grown in different directions. Even brief encounters can leave lifelong fingerprints on our hearts.
The humorous truth is that humans love trying to negotiate with destiny. “Can I keep the life lesson and the person?” Sometimes yes. Sometimes the answer is a gentle no. The value of the connection isn’t measured by its duration but by its transformation.
If someone helped you become more authentic, more compassionate, or more courageous, their spiritual purpose may already have been fulfilled. And who knows?
